This small breed is at a higher chance of developing hypoglycemia. Hypoglycemia is a condition where not enough energy reaches the blood. This can cause symptoms including confusion, lethargy, weakness, and vomiting. If not treated, it could lead to seizures or even a insanity. To avoid this, pet parents should give their Biewer Terriers regular meals of high-quality dog food and monitor them closely for indicators of low blood sugar levels.
Biewers can also suffer from tracheal collapsing, which is an illness in which the cartilage of the windpipe becomes weaker, Bruno mini Yorkshire terrier kaufen leading to breathing issues. This is particularly frequent in puppies and can be an outcome of overexertion, stress or excitement; eating or drinking; and exposure to humidity or heat. Pet parents can reduce the risk by not placing pressure on their dog's neck when walking or using harnesses.

The Biewer Britta yorkshire terrier welpen kaufen Terrier, a rare purebred, is the product of a recessive gene piebald in two Yorkies that were bred together. It is small in size, weighing between four and eight pounds, and stands between seven and 11 inches tall. The silky coat requires regular care to prevent it from becoming tangled.
